How Long You Want Effects to Last

The next thing that you should consider when choosing a consumption method is how long you are wanting the effects to last. Again, this consideration is quite important, since every consumption method has different onset times and duration of effects.

If you just want the effects to last for an hour or two, then you can use a bong or smoke a joint. Again, dry herb vaporizers are also an option for this, and they have a slightly shorter duration of effects compared to smoking. If you want the effects to last for quite a while, then edibles would be the perfect choice for you, since they have a duration of effects at around 8 hours.
